Output 58f8d61b865f8173898788ef17f10671cec128548c6d889ee8eada32391de0a5:0

value
11477000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997ecbb10685d0b05b3a888e0355e2e93771a4ad OP_EQUAL
address
3FgdCp1pK33gy46LpzLQ6hcU3hdjkFQoc1
transaction
58f8d61b865f8173898788ef17f10671cec128548c6d889ee8eada32391de0a5
spent
true